Definición

To gain knowledge, skill, or understanding from someone or something, especially by observing, experiencing, or reflecting on what happened.

Uso & Matices

Commonly used when one gains insight after an event or from someone's example or mistake ('learn from mistakes', 'learn from others'). More formal or neutral; usually followed by a noun or pronoun. Don't confuse with just 'learn'.
